Церковь Успения Пресвятой Богородицы

The Church of the Assumption of the Holy Virgin is believed to have been constructed between 1857 and 1868.

  • The church is an example of Russian Orthodox architectural style, characterized by its distinctive onion-shaped domes. The building's design is attributed to a renowned architect of the time.

The church is located on улица Базар in the town of Алексеевка, Russia.
